Paint Correction Swirl Marks Removal: How It Works and Why It Matters

Swirl marks can make a clean car look dull in direct sunlight. But here’s the good news: most of this damage lives only in the clear coat. It doesn’t touch the paint color underneath. Professional paint correction swirl marks removal reduces or removes these clear-coat defects. It restores depth and gloss. It doesn’t just cover the problem up.

What Causes Swirl Marks on a Car’s Clear Coat?

Swirl marks are fine scratches in the clear coat. The clear coat is the see-through layer above the color. Swirl marks show up as circular or web-like patterns under sunlight, garage lights, or gas station lights. Despite the name, most of them aren’t truly circular. Their shape just follows whatever motion caused them.

Improper washing causes most swirl marks. A dirty wash mitt drags grit across the paint. Rough towels do the same. So do automatic car wash brushes. So does wiping a dusty car dry. Each of these turns small particles into tiny abrasives. Those abrasives leave behind micro-scratches. Even careful owners cause swirl marks. It happens when they press too hard, skip a pre-rinse, or reuse a dirty tool.

Central Florida driving conditions make this worse. Pollen, road film, bugs, hard-water spots, and constant sun all leave residue on the paint. Wiping that residue off carelessly creates new scratches. Over time, this scratching and light oxidation dull the paint’s shine. That’s why a car can look tired right after a wash.

What Is Paint Correction Swirl Marks Removal?

Paint correction swirl marks removal is a controlled polishing process. It is not a repaint. A trained detailer smooths a microscopic layer of the clear coat. This lets light reflect evenly again. Here’s how the process usually works.

Step 1: Wash and Decontaminate

The car is washed and decontaminated first. This step removes bonded grime — tar, rail dust, industrial fallout. Skipping it risks dragging that grit across the paint during polishing, which would create new scratches. Next, the detailer inspects the paint under bright, direct lighting. This maps out swirl marks, haze, water spots, and oxidation.

Step 2: Machine Polish the Clear Coat

Next, the detailer uses a machine polisher, a matched pad, and the right polish. Tiny abrasives in that polish smooth out the clear coat around each scratch. Light then reflects evenly off the surface. The swirl marks fade or disappear. This is what separates real correction from a glaze. A glaze hides defects for a short time. Machine polishing actually corrects the clear coat, within safe limits.

What Swirl Marks Removal Can (and Can’t) Fix

Swirl marks removal works well on light wash scratches, mild haze, oxidation, and shallow water spots. Deep scratches that cut past the clear coat often stay partly visible. Removing them fully would strip away too much material. A skilled detailer weighs visible improvement against long-term paint health. Is Swirl Marks Removal Necessary Before Ceramic Coating?

Yes. Paint correction usually comes before ceramic coating — replace with your confirmed page URL. A coating locks in whatever condition the paint is already in. It doesn’t remove existing swirl marks on its own. Correcting the paint first means the coating adds real gloss and water-repelling protection to a truly clear surface. Ceramic coating still isn’t scratch-proof. Paint-safe washing still matters after correction. The International Detailing Association, the main certification body for the detailing industry, backs this order: clean, correct, then protect.

OUR STUDIO

The environment in which we work has a huge affect on the quality of work produced. For us, this means having two separate climate-controlled spaces to accommodate for spikes in heat and humidity. It means separating our high-end detailing services to prevent contamination in film and coating applications. Our Downtown Orlando studio is 5,600 sq. ft. of air conditioned space with 2,500 sq. ft. dedicated to clean PPF and coating applications. We have an indoor wash bay with warm and deionized water. We utilize Rupes machines, LED overhead lighting, and Scangrip/LED portable lighting. We have a 4-post lift, scissor lift, and QuickJacks portable car lifts. Our spaces are separately outfitted with right LED lighting for the specific work being performed. We have CCTV security cameras inside and out, with 24-hr armed on-property security monitoring.
